Beware online shopping!

About a few month ago I was cruising a blog and I found a hair product that really interested me. It was given a rave review from the blogger and I felt like it could possibly work for me. Even though I searched the internet for more reviews I didn't see any. But I did what any other reader would do.. I purchased a jar of this product.


After my transaction, I realized that I didn't get a receipt BUT the money was removed from my account.

Bizarre... but I told myself wait a bit because I really wanted the product. A week with no receipt went by and I sent them an email. I included my name, email, Paypal transaction number and date I purchased. I received NO answer.

I then sent another email inquiring about the product delivery. NO ANSWER.

To make a long story short. I filed a claim to Paypal. Paypal sent me a refund because the company did NOT respond back to Paypal.

They did respond back to me after a month with a sob story about how the website had errors...

I will tell you the product cost $7.99.. petty cash to some but honestly it's the principal.

I didn't write this to cause problems.. I didn't even put the bloggers name or company. I just want you all to pay attention to the online companies that you buy from. If something seems wrong please "speak" up. 

Also always use Paypal if you can!

A lot of women are interested in gaining length quickly but don't understand that a cheap $20.00 pack from the local beauty store is not the key for long term. I got low down on 100% Human Hair Extensions from Bella Dream Hair.
"The difference between Bella Dream Hair and your local Beauty Supply Store is quality. The grade of hair is completely different" says Constance from Bella Dream Hair. "BDH offers pure virgin hair from donors. The hair is pure virgin human hair that can be dyed and styled as desired. Our hair will last you over a year if taken care of properly".

A year is a long time but I wanted to know more about how to maintain & treat the hair. Since it was my first time inquiring about this blend! "The hair life will honestly depends on the care the customer takes with their hair. If you apply heat and chemicals to your extensions it will damage it quicker. If you over treat your hair it will damage. This hair is no different then the hair on your scalp you MUST take care of it. If you don't deep condition your extensions then yes your hair will start to shed and fall out become dry and brittle just like your own would. A lot of women don't realize that just because you are wearing a weave does not mean you shouldn't care for your hair." says Constance.

 Source: google images
Those are some powerful words.

Honestly my skin cringes when I see Britney Spears. She needs some BDH love!

 Britney is the best segue into extension application. She is wearing fusions hair extensions. "Fusion is not for everyone again if done right it's great, a way you can wear your hair in versatile fashions but if done wrong it can damage your hair." Constance

 NOBODY wants the "Britney" look. So I asked about other methods!
"Bonding glue is nothing to be afraid of. If used properly it will not damage your hair at all. The problem is people that do not apply bonding glue in the appropriate spots. Glue is actually a Hollywood beauty secret and one of the best ways to use for extensions, but again that's if it's done properly. I have found that women wearing sewn in methods will cause more damage to your hair and scalp due to the tension braiding and sewing creates on your head. Again, braiding extensions on is another well done technique that can benefit a woman's hair growth as well as harm her hair if not done right. There are many methods available for women of every ethnicities."Constance
